Con Brio by Josef Lorenzl & Crejo. Ca. 1930.
Cold painted Art Deco bronze figurine of a dancer in an elegant stretched pose. The silver colored bronze surface further enhanced with enamel floral pattern and signed and painted by in-house artist Crejo. The figure placed on a domed bronze base signed Lorenzl and further raised on a Brazilian green onyx plinth.

Propaganda:
Minimoog Voyager: "A classic analogue synth and the last to be designed by the late Dr Robert Moog. It looks like a classic synth and the controls are clearly labelled and grouped well, following the standard flow left-to right of oscillators, filters and envelopes. The case is black metal in a wooden frame. The Signature Edition had a choice of maple, cherry or walnut finish and any of there looked superb. Even the more standard Performer Edition has a satin-smooth maple frame. Outstanding features of this model are the tiltable panel, ideal for when the instrument is on a stand, and the touch panel, which can modify various control inputs."
